THE BEST VALENTINE’S SEASON LASH STYLES
- THE ROMANTIC WISPY. The all-round Valentine’s MVP. Fine, feathery fibers that taper at the ends and a soft curl. It instantly adds “animated eyes” without looking artificial. Perfect for dinner dates, cocktail nights, and every photo you’ll take in your outfit before leaving the house.
- THE CAT-EYE TEMPTRESS. Outer-corner length that flicks up like a subtle eyeliner wing. This is the style for when you want his gaze drawn to the corners of your face, toward your cheekbones and jawline. A confident, alluring look that photographs beautifully.
- THE DOE-EYE DELIGHT. Longer in the center of the eye, which makes you look wide-eyed, curious, and a little innocent. It’s the flutter-down-blink lash. Ideal for the shy flirt who wants her eyes to do the talking.
- THE SHIMMER TOUCH. A wispy style with subtly lighter tips. In candlelight and low-light restaurants, these catches warm light and make your eyes look liquid and bright. Unfairly gorgeous effect for very little effort.
- THE WHISP VOLUME. Three ultra-light layers that create volume without the weight. It’s the “I woke up like this (but better)” lash. Perfect for afternoon Valentine’s brunches or daytime dates where you want a soft romance, not full glam.
HOW TO KEEP YOUR VALENTINE LASHES ON ALL NIGHT
Beautiful lashes mean nothing if they’re lifting at the corner by the time the main course arrives. Here’s my professional survival guide:
- Start with clean, dry lashes. Any trace of mascara or leftover adhesive and your new lashes won’t have a clean surface to grab onto.
- Trim the band to your exact eye width. Not “close to” — exact. A band that stretches into your inner corner is the #1 cause of evening lift.
- Press the band against the lash line, not your eyelid skin. Right where your natural lashes start. Give it 15 solid seconds.
- Skip the extra mascara. Applying mascara over strip lashes adds weight that pulls the band loose. If you need more drama, pick a more dramatic lash instead.
WHAT TO LOOK FOR IN VALENTINE’S LASHES
Bring this checklist to your search: lightweight fibers that won’t droop by hour two, a thin invisible band that doesn’t catch candlelight, varied lengths (tapered, not blunt), and a curl that holds its shape in misty, humid restaurant air. One more: choose a pair you can comfortably wear from 6pm dinner to midnight — if it’s annoying at 9pm, it’s the wrong lash.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
What lashes look best in candlelight?
Darker, matte lashes with subtle wispy layers. They adsorb warm light beautifully and create depth. Avoid shiny bands over curled fibers — they reflect light in unflattering ways.
How do I make sure lashes stay on during a romantic dinner?
Use a small amount of lash adhesive on the outer corner of the band — the most common place for lifting — and press firmly for 15 seconds after placement. Also avoid oily foods touching your eye area.
What lash length looks noticeable but natural for Valentine’s?
Stick to 12–13mm at the outer corner, 10–11mm in the center. That range is long enough to be seen and felt, short enough to avoid crossing into costume territory.
